Position Overview

We are seeking a motivated, detail-oriented HRIS Analyst II to join our HRIS team. The ideal candidate will bring 2.5 – 5 years of HR or HRIS experience and hands-on exposure to benefits configuration, administration, testing, reporting, and process improvement. This role will also serve as a functional resource for compensation, recruiting, and other Workday modules.

The HRIS Analyst II will partner closely with Microchip HR and external vendors to ensure accurate benefits data, efficient business processes, and a positive employee experience. Key responsibilities include supporting annual enrollment activities, benefits integrations, audits, compliance requirements, and ongoing Workday system enhancements.

The successful candidate will have a solid understanding of HR processes and data management, strong analytical skills, and exceptional attention to detail. Microchip welcomes candidates who have foundational HR systems knowledge and are eager to deepen their Workday expertise, as well as professionals with related systems experience who are looking to enter the Workday ecosystem.

In this role, the HRIS Analyst II will help maintain accurate, up-to-date employee data, support the smooth operation of the Workday platform, and provide responsive HRIS support to Microchip’s global HR team.

Responsibilities

  • Serve as a key point of contact for Workday Benefit system-related inquiries, issues, and administration.

  • Configure and maintain benefit eligibility rules, events, rates, plan changes, and enrollment processes.

  • Troubleshoot and resolve benefits-related system issues and data discrepancies.

  • Assist with annual Open Enrollment planning, testing, deployment, and post-enrollment audits.

  • Serve as a functional resource for Benefits, Compensation, Recruiting and other Workday modules.

  • Perform system testing for Workday releases, enhancements, and changes.

  • Create and maintain configuration and process documentation.

  • Develop and maintain Workday reports, dashboards, and calculated fields.

  • Provide general HR system support, including troubleshooting user issues and resolving system-related problems.

  • Assist in the development and delivery of training materials and resources for HR users

  • Provide ad hoc reporting and data support to HR leadership and teams.

  • Support benefits-related integrations with carriers and third-party vendors, including integration monitoring and troubleshooting.

  • Support quarterly and off-cycle compensation processes, recruitment configurations, and AI initiatives.

  • Participate in audits and support required document requests.

  • Utilize integration processes to manually load data into the Workday environment.

  • Stay up to date with industry trends and best practices in HR technology and systems administration.

  • Maintain confidentiality and security of employee information.

What We Do

Microchip Technology Inc. is a leading semiconductor supplier of smart, connected and secure embedded control solutions. Its easy-to-use development tools and comprehensive product portfolio enable customers to create optimal designs which reduce risk while lowering total system cost and time to market. The company’s solutions serve more than 125,000 customers across the industrial, automotive, consumer, aerospace and defense, communications and computing markets. Headquartered in Chandler, Arizona, Microchip offers outstanding technical support along with dependable delivery and quality.
